Getting to Carrollton: What to Expect

The journey from either major airport to Carrollton follows major highways such as I‑35E, the President George Bush Turnpike, and the Sam Rayburn Tollway. Under normal traffic conditions the ride generally takes roughly half an hour to an hour, though peak‑hour congestion, weather, or construction can extend that window. Your driver will monitor live traffic data and adjust the route accordingly, aiming for the most efficient path.

Pickup is typically arranged at the designated rideshare/shuttle zone outside the terminal, clearly marked with signage. For departures, the driver will confirm the exact terminal and airline curbside location ahead of time. Drop‑off points in Carrollton can be any address you provide — hotels along the I‑35E corridor, corporate campuses near the Dallas North Tollway, or residential streets in neighborhoods like Old Town, Carrollton Heights, or the rapidly growing area around the Carrollton Town Center. The service is flexible enough to accommodate multiple stops if you’re traveling with colleagues or family members heading to different locations.

Things to Do in Carrollton

Carrollton blends historic charm with modern amenities, giving visitors plenty of reasons to linger beyond a quick airport transfer. Below are some of the most visited attractions and neighborhoods that showcase the city’s character.

  • Historic Downtown Carrollton — Brick‑paved streets, locally owned boutiques, and a collection of restaurants housed in restored early‑20th‑century buildings. The area hosts a weekly farmers market (seasonal) and the annual Carrollton Festival at the Plaza, featuring live music, food trucks, and artisan vendors.
  • A.W. Perry Homestead Museum — A preserved 1909 farmhouse offering guided tours that illustrate early settler life in North Texas. The surrounding grounds include a heritage garden and occasional living‑history demonstrations.
  • Carrollton Town Center — A mixed‑use development with a modern public plaza, splash pad, and a lineup of national retailers alongside local eateries. The center’s outdoor amphitheater hosts summer concert series and holiday light displays.
  • Sandy Lake Park — A 100‑acre recreational area with a stocked fishing lake, walking trails, picnic pavilions, and a popular disc‑golf course. The park also features a seasonal amusement area with a carousel and miniature train, making it a family favorite.
  • Oak Creek Tennis Center — Public courts with lighting, a pro shop, and regular league play. The facility hosts USTA tournaments and offers lessons for all skill levels.
  • Indian Creek Golf Club — Two 18‑hole courses (the Creek and the Lakes) set among rolling hills and mature trees. The clubhouse includes a grill with patio seating overlooking the fairways.
  • Rosemeade Rainforest Aquatic Complex — A water‑park style pool with a lazy river, slides, and a zero‑depth entry area, open during the summer months for residents and visitors alike.
  • Neighborhood Highlights — Old Town Carrollton retains a small‑town feel with historic homes and the Carrollton Public Library’s main branch. Carrollton Heights offers newer master‑planned communities with easy access to the President George Bush Turnpike. The area around the DART Green Line’s North Carrollton/Frankford Station provides transit‑oriented dining and apartment living.

Seasonal events such as the Carrollton Fourth of July Parade, the Holiday Lights Celebration at the Town Center, and the monthly Art Walk in downtown draw both locals and out‑of‑town guests.
